Meghalaya has two very different faces, and the best time to visit depends on which you want to see.
October to May — clear and easy
The dry season brings pleasant weather, easy trekking and clear views — ideal for the root bridges, Dawki and general sightseeing.
June to September — the great monsoon
As one of the wettest places on Earth, Meghalaya's monsoon turns the waterfalls thunderous and the hills emerald. Drives are slower and trails slippery, but the drama is unmatched.
Our recommendation
For most clients, October–April is the sweet spot; monsoon lovers and photographers should aim for July–August.
- Sightseeing: Oct–April
- Waterfalls at their best: Jun–Sep
- Carry rain gear year-round
- Book root-bridge treks for the dry season
